Monaco — David Natroshvili has been welcomed as a member of the Yacht Club de Monaco, one of the world's most prestigious and exclusive maritime institutions, at a ceremony presided over by its President, H.S.H. Prince Albert II of Monaco.
Founded in 1953 and led by Prince Albert II since 1984, the Yacht Club de Monaco stands at the centre of the Principality's maritime life, bringing together an international membership around a shared culture of the sea. Its headquarters on Port Hercules is among the most recognised addresses in the yachting world.
Membership is not open to application. It is extended by personal invitation from the Prince of Monaco alone, and the Club's rolls remain among the most closely held in the world — a distinction reserved for individuals whose standing and contribution align with its traditions.The induction took place before the Club's officers and existing membership, with new members formally received on the day.
